Manish Shanker Sharma promoted to DGP Grade in Madhya Pradesh

Posted on March 1, 2025March 1, 2025 by Staff Reporter

Manish Shanker Sharma, a 1992 batch IPS officer from the Madhya Pradesh cadre, has been elevated to the rank of Director General of Police (DGP). His promotion reflects his extensive experience and contributions to law enforcement in the state.
